ABSTRACT

This chapter makes the case that, whilst there have been significant increases in both access to and quality of education, much more needs to be done, particularly for children in the low- and middle-income countries. It also highlights that current progress is at risk of being seriously eroded by COVID-19. Recognizing that, in the medium-term, financial resources for education are likely to be globally constrained, we make the case for seeking to leverage more from less – for getting Lean. This introductory chapter also provides an overview of the overall structure of the book, key messages, the potential for deep controversy, and our cigarette packet health warnings about the methodology and approach.
